Tennessee Statutes

§ 68-221-1203 — Part definitions

Tennessee·Title 68

Terms used in this part that are defined in §§ 68-221-703 and 68-221-1003 shall have the same meaning in this part. As used in this part, unless the context otherwise requires:

(1)"Federal act" means the Safe Drinking Water Act, or Title XIV of the Public Health Service Act ( 42 U.S.C. § 300f et seq.), as amended, and rules and regulations promulgated thereunder;
(2)"Fund" means the water system revolving loan fund;
(3)"Loan" means loans, loan guarantees, or a source of reserve and security for leveraged loans;
(4)"Security" means that which is determined by the authority to be acceptable to secure a loan to a water system under this part and includes, but is not limited to, dedicated or other revenues of the system, collateral, letters of credit, and surety bonds;

Legislative History

Amended by 2015 Tenn. Acts, ch. 207, s 1, eff. 4/20/2015. Acts 1997 , ch. 483, § 4; 2002, ch. 603, § 6; 2009 , ch. 409, § 3.
